Keeper of Enchanted Rooms by Charlie N. Holmberg

My rating: 5 of 5 stars


Oh my word – I LOVED this book!
Merritt is estranged from his family but suddenly (and quite surprisingly) inherits a house when his grandmother dies. He’s an author, and his living situation isn’t exactly the greatest, so he packs up his few things and heads on over to Whimbrel House…to find out that it is haunted-ish.
Hulda shows up from BIKER (Boston Institute for the Keeping of Enchanted Rooms) and immediately sets to work identifying the exact type of haunting and hiring a maid and cook. Hulda has experience with enchanted homes and starts to find that her past catches up with her.
Just what exactly is that past? And what IS Merritt’s connection to the house (and BIKER)? While I saw the end coming, it was definitely not in the way I expected it.
